Chairman of the Joint Chiefs Gen. Dan Caine and his staff have been involved in working through potential security guarantees for Ukraine ahead of today’s meetings at the White House, according to a source familiar with the planning.
European governments are also holding similar discussions, the source added.
They did not provide details on what possibilities for US involvement are under discussion.
While Trump declined to rule out sending US troops to Ukraine, the source familiar with the planning process noted that the important part of the president’s comments was his apparent willingness to be involved in some way. Caine’s involvement in the planning process would appear to further demonstrate that the US is seriously prepared to help.

Trump broke away from the meeting with the seven for a brief personal call with Vladimir Putin. He said he had promised to do so, much as he had called Zelenskyy immediately after the meeting in Anchorage on Friday.
President Trump called Russian President Vladimir Putin on Monday while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ky and seven European leaders were gathered in the White House, two sources familiar with the call tell Axios
Why it matters: Trump said earlier Monday that Putin was expecting a call from him after the talks concluded. Trump said he hoped to quickly arrange a trilateral summit involving both Putin and Zelensky, but Putin has yet to agree to that idea.
- Trump similarly called Zelensky after his summit with Putin concluded.
- In this case, though, Trump took a break from his meeting with the Europeans to place the call. Bild first reported the Trump-Putin call.
- Trump expressed optimism during his meeting with Zelensky and in the larger meeting with the European leaders about the prospect of a trilateral summit, and a peace deal soon thereafter.
